To get a jump on this before it needs addressing, here are the official procedures on rehoming and inactivity. These also apply if a player is blacklisted, but we hope that never happens!
If you fail to meet the activity requirements (one post per six months and six posts per year) then your child will be given to another roleplayer. You will retain the right to display the child in your sig and will have a copy of the cert with your name on it, but your child will be roleplayed by someone else, and they will also have a copy of the cert with their name on it.
In this way, you will continue to have an active, growing child, even if you do not have the time to roleplay or participate in the shop. You will still be the owner of a Patch child, you will simply not be the roleplayer of the character. Because we never revoke your ownership, we do not refund for any Patch children for any reason.
You have the right to pick a new player for your child, assuming that person has not been blacklisted from the shop. Please post in this thread with the Gaia name of the person you would like your child to be played by in the event of your inactivity. You may have a second choice if the first person declines or is unavailable.
You may NOT resell your child for any reason. Any player transfers must be 100% free. Replacement roleplayers please be aware: If we discover that you have purchased your child from the original owner in some way, we will remove the child from you and permanently ban the owner from the shop.
In the event you are unable to choose a new player, or if you have no preference for a new player, your child will be rehomed in a roleplay event run by the shop. If you wish and have the time for it, you may participate in the contest judging. You may not refuse to rehome your child unless you want to kill the character. Killing your character is permanent and you will not be refunded, as it is your choice that the character be killed. You must have prior shop approval to kill your character.
Be forewarned: if your child gets a replacement player, that person is entitled to roleplay the character so long as he or she is active. You may not reclaim the roleplay rights to your child unless the replacement player agrees to let you, or lapses in the activity requirements (or is blacklisted).
If a replacement player is unable to keep up the activity requirement, he or she loses all rights to the child. Replacement players may not pick new players unless they have the express consent of the original owner to do so. If a replacement player is inactive, the original owner can choose a new player again.
!!IMPORTANT!! We will not track you down when we rehome your child. If you do not make your wishes known in this thread prior to your child being rehomed, the shop will assume you have no preference in the matter and do as it sees best.
Additional Note: You cannot transfer your child to a new player until you have received your third strike and your time as roleplayer is up. If you wish to rehome your child prior to receiving a third strike, it must be done by the shop in a contest open to all. This is to prevent abuse of the rehoming procedures by people who might want to circumvent our contests and purchasing system (for example, entering a writing contest just to give the child to a friend who might not have been able to win the contest).
The Youth Clause Once your child reaches Youth, s/he can never be rehomed if you are the original player. If you lapse in your activity, you may be asked to take Youth as Adult for your final stage rather than be allowed to pursue Mature Adult.
For replacement players, you will retain your roleplay guardianship of the character until such a time as you lapse in activity AND the original player requests return of guardianship. If the original player makes such a request and you are still active, their request will be denied. If you lapse in your activity but the original player doesn't request guardianship back, you will still continue as roleplay guardian.
These rules also apply to both forms of Adult stage.

The Probation Program
Here at the Patch, we do believe in second chances, and if you lost the right to roleplay your child it is possible for you to get that right back under certain circumstances.
- It must have been at least one year from the time of your banning. - Your child's current roleplayer must be inactive or agree to let you back. Harassing said player to return your child will result in permabanning! - If your child's roleplayer is active, you may instead choose to take the next child available for rehoming.
Our probation program operates just like our warning system: you're allowed to come back twice, and if you screw up a third time, you're out for good, and you will not be invited to roleplay your character ever again.
This isn't something we will track down and offer to you, it's something you have to ask us for, thus displaying your renewed interest in participating in the Patch. If you have lost your child and the above conditions apply, please PM the mule to discuss your return!
When you return, your warnings are reset, so if you lapse in activity you again get two warnings before we rehome your child.

Warning Forgiveness Program
In light of the fact some individuals may wish to turn their Patch activity around without having their child rehomed, the following forgiveness policies are henceforth activated:
- If you have one warning and go eighteen months without incurring any further warning, your warning will be forgiven.
- If you have two warnings and go one year without incurring any further warning, one of your warnings will be forgiven.
So, if you've managed to receive two warnings, don't despair! Stay on track for one year, and you'll go back to one warning. If you stay on track an additional eighteen months, your status will return to zero warnings! Two warnings is not the end of the universe if you don't want it to be. (And while two and a half years is a long time to get back to zero warnings, just remember: at one warning, you're safe from having your child seized and rehomed, and warnings only come at most once every six months.)
